In article <20850 at versatc.versatec.COM> tamura at versatc.versatec.COM (Mark Tamura) writes:
> question: what is equivalent routine for spl4() on the ULTRIX-32 (RISC) V3.0
> systems?  using spl4() seems to give me an unresolved reference.  is splbio()
> an appropriate substitution?  thanks.

I think all the splx() references are normally expanded by "inline", which
means that there are not neccessarily any real splx() subroutines to link
to.  Try improving your compilation procedure to invoke inline and see if
your problems go away - use the kernel makefile for reference.
